Post 8 Your summer holidays



You have to write about your plans or ideas for these summer holidays.

Among other things, they should write about:

> Places you are going to / would like to visit
> People you are going to / would like to be with 
> When you are going and for how much time
> Activities you are thinking of doing
> How much money you will take and what you'll spend on with it

- Leave a comment on my sample post + 3 of your classmates posts.
- Word Count for post 8: 280 words

Level 4 >> Post 10 (week 13): English Language Challenges

Talk about your English learning experience
  • What comments can you make about your experience learning English at university? What about the use of blogs?
  • What aspects of your English need to be improved and how do you plan to do this?
  • Outside the English class, how much are you using English these days? What for? Speaking? Reading?
  • How do you expect to use English in the future, once you've finished your undergraduate studies?


- Wordcount: 260

- Make comments on 3 of your partners' posts.
